/**
* Ensure a runnable will run on the main thread after running all pending
* updates that were sent from the graph thread or will be sent before the
* graph thread receives the next graph update.
*
* If the graph has been shutdown or destroyed, or if it is non-realtime
* and has not started, then the runnable will be run
* synchronously/immediately. (There are no pending updates in these
* situations.)
*
* Main thread only.
*/
void RunAfterPendingUpdates(nsRefPtr<nsIRunnable> aRunnable);
